Mercedes-Benz C-Class Debut

The new C-Class has been revealed to an international audience for the first time at Geneva, along with green and racing versions.

The details of the C-Class have already been covered in a recent feature /link . The race car is a 470bhp V8 monster which defending champion Bernd Schneider, 2006 runner-up Bruno Spengler, twice F1 title holder Mika Hakkinen and young British driver Jamie Green will be racing in this year's German Touring Car Masters (DTM) championship.

The green car is the Vision C 220 Bluetec, which uses similar technology to that found in the Vision GL 420 Bluetec displayed at Detroit (see separate story ). Bluetec has been developed to reduce emissions from diesel engines - particularly oxides of nitrogen , which are the only pollutants that diesels continue to pump out in greater quantities than petrol engines do.

With this car, Mercedes is on its way to meeting the Euro IV emissions regulations, which do not come into force until 2015. The Vision C 220 doesn't go that far, but it's efficient enough to achieve 51.3mpg on the combined EU fuel economy cycle.
